According to art historian John Rowlands, "Although this … WebHans Holbein the Younger was born circa 1497 in Augsburg in Bavaria, Germany. He was the son of the artist and draughtsman Hans Holbein the Elder (1465-1524). The Holbeins were an accomplished artistic family: Hans the Younger’s uncles (Sigmund and Michael) and his older brother (Ambrosius) also pursued art. By 1515, Ambrosius and Hans had ...

WebOct 19, 2024 · The 16 th- century German artist Hans Holbein the Younger created portraits for a wide range of patrons, including scholars, statesmen, and courtiers, in Switzerland and England. Holbein’s drawings and paintings, enriched by inscriptions and evocative objects, offer richly detailed visual statements of personal identity. WebHolbein was one of the most accomplished portraitists of the 16th century. He spent two periods of his life in England (1526-8 and 1532-43), portraying the nobility of the Tudor court. WebJan 6, 2024 · Hans Holbein was a son of Hans Holbein, hence he is the Younger. Born in Augsburg, Germany, by 1515 he moved to Basel. In 1523, he painted his first portraits of Erasmus, the man who opened the path for him to travel to England, by recommendation to Thomas Moore.

WebPortrait of Henry VIII is a lost work by Hans Holbein the Younger depicting Henry VIII. It was destroyed by fire in 1698, but is still well known through many copies.
